How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Garland?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Garland Studio Apartments | $1,057 | $556 | $1,680 |
| Garland 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,276 | $590 | $4,026 |
| Garland 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,713 | $696 | $4,045 |
Garland 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,264 | $1,348 | $7,134 |
| Garland 4 Bedroom Apartments | $2,745 | $2,423 | $3,076 |

Frequently Asked Questions about 3 Bedroom Garland Apartments
What is the Cheapest apartment in Garland with 3 Bedroom?
Currently the most affordable 3 Bedroom in Garland is at The Summit Apartments listed at $1,270.
How much is the average rent for a 3 Bedroom Garland Apartment?
The average rent for a 3 Bedroom Apartment in Garland is $2,264.
What is the largest available 3 Bedroom Garland Apartment for rent?
Today's apartment with the most square footage in Garland is a 2,676 square feet unit starting from $2,310 at BRIO at Firewheel.
What is the average size for Garland 3 Bedroom Apartments for rent?
The average size for a 3 Bedroom rental in Garland is currently 1,796 sq ft.
